  • Patent number: 4644464
    Abstract: A parallel register-transfer mechanism and control section have been disclosed above for use in a reduction process for the evaluation of expressions of a variable-free applicative language stored as binary directed graphs. The expressions are reduced through a series of transformations until a result is obtained.

  • Patent number: 4598361
    Abstract: An allocator for a reduction processor which evaluates programs stored as binary graphs employing variable-free applicative language codes. These graphs are made up of nodes, each of which exists in memory and contains as its most significant bit a mark bit which when set indicates that the node is being used in a graph and when reset indicates that the node or storage location is available for future use by the processor. The allocator scans selected groups of storage locations in parallel to see if there are any unused storage locations and then places the addresses of those unused storage locations in a queue for use by the processor.
